    I am also using polylang 1.9.3 as the site has to be multilingual.

    The problem is that sometimes the main menu links redirect to the slider landing page instead of the right horizontal section. It happens when:

    a. I open any blog post and click on any main menu link.
    b. I change language using the language menu

    Rest of the time the menu behaves as expected, sliding to the right to the proper section of the website.

    My custom URLs are like this:

    https://spanish16.audiogil.es/es/#home/centro
    https://spanish16.audiogil.es/es/#home/cursos

    I’ve set up polylang so that the start page’s name is hidden in the URL, but not doing so also fails to solve the problem.

    Most confusing, in either (a) or (b) case, when I click on any menu link, the right URL briefly appears inside the address bar, but the section part disappears in the blink of an eye and the slider page is loaded instead. For example:

    https://spanish16.audiogil.es/es/#home/cursos

    is automatically transformed into:

    https://spanish16.audiogil.es/es/#home

    Besides, if after loading the start page for the firt time I manually add the suffix corresponding to the section part, for instance “cursos”:

    https://spanish16.audiogil.es/es/#home/cursos

    then the right section does appear indeed, *but* if I open a new tab or window and type again the *full* url all I get is the slider page (!!).

    Seems to me that some forwarding or address rewriting is going on… maybe Polylang is to blame?

    We would like to inform you that we are aware of this issue and that Scroll me has some issues being turned into a Multi language site.

    Scroll me is based on the URL for the Horizontal scroll effect and Multi language site seems to be also based on changing the site URL which the theme does not seem too work with.

    We are looking into this issue and hope to solve this issue in the future updates.
